Problem

Existing sofa beds face issues such as increased rear occupation when folding, mechanical complexity, need for additional storage for cushions, excessive depth or width in configurations, and discomfort due to articulation placement, especially when transitioning between sofa and bed modes.

Innovation Solution

A sofa bed design featuring a support structure with a foldable leg rest, a cushioned flexible body, and automatic unfolding mechanisms, including parallel mechanisms and adjustable height arms, allowing for a wide bed configuration without excessive depth or storage needs, and providing leg support in intermediate positions.

AI summary

A sofa bed including a support structure configured to be placed on the floor, a main seat base arranged on the support structure, a front foldable leg rest fixed to the structure by a first articulation, and a cushioned flexible body that covers the main base and the leg rest is disclosed herein. The first articulation includes parallel mechanisms configured to provide a movement on a vertical plane with a combined movement of folding and a forward motion of the leg rest, the leg rest includes at least one lower leg, the cushioned flexible body includes machined parts and an upper layer with a greater elasticity than the rest of the cushioned body in an area that coincides with the first articulation. The sofa bed further includes foldable support elements located under the cushioned body in an area coinciding with the at least one machined part.
